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2421802 861277038 808
09 852
09 852
2772 993279689 25
All about undefined
Interested in learning more?
09 852
2772 993279689 25
See more
046190 856660328 23374
26468 071513296 13376 8473757 304252041
See more
30 41930
63079454 29 89 702
See more